package com.koushikdutta.async.http.body;
import com.koushikdutta.async.ByteBufferList;
import com.koushikdutta.async.DataEmitter;
import com.koushikdutta.async.DataSink;
import com.koushikdutta.async.Util;
import com.koushikdutta.async.callback.CompletedCallback;
import com.koushikdutta.async.callback.DataCallback;
import com.koushikdutta.async.http.AsyncHttpRequest;
import com.koushikdutta.async.http.Multimap;
import com.koushikdutta.async.util.Charsets;
import org.apache.http.NameValuePair;
import java.io.UnsupportedEncodingException;
import java.net.URLEncoder;
import java.util.List;
public class UrlEncodedFormBody implements AsyncHttpRequestBody<Multimap> {
private Multimap mParameters;
private byte[] mBodyBytes;
public UrlEncodedFormBody(Multimap parameters) {
mParameters = parameters;
}
public UrlEncodedFormBody(List<NameValuePair> parameters) {
mParameters = new Multimap(parameters);
}
private void buildData() {
boolean first = true;
StringBuilder b = new StringBuilder();
try {
for (NameValuePair pair: mParameters) {
if (pair.getValue() == null)
continue;
if (!first)
b.append('&');
first = false;
b.append(URLEncoder.encode(pair.getName(), "UTF-8"));
b.append('=');
b.append(URLEncoder.encode(pair.getValue(), "UTF-8"));
}
mBodyBytes = b.toString().getBytes("UTF-8");
}
catch (UnsupportedEncodingException e) {
}
}
@Override
public void write(AsyncHttpRequest request, final DataSink response, final CompletedCallback completed) {
if (mBodyBytes == null)
buildData();
Util.writeAll(response, mBodyBytes, completed);
}
public static final String CONTENT_TYPE = "application/x-www-form-urlencoded";
@Override
public String getContentType() {
return CONTENT_TYPE + "; charset=utf8";
}
@Override
public void parse(DataEmitter emitter, final CompletedCallback completed) {
final ByteBufferList data = new ByteBufferList();
emitter.setDataCallback(new DataCallback() {
@Override
public void onDataAvailable(DataEmitter emitter, ByteBufferList bb) {
bb.get(data);
}
});
emitter.setEndCallback(new CompletedCallback() {
@Override
public void onCompleted(Exception ex) {
if (ex != null) {
completed.onCompleted(ex);
return;
}
try {
mParameters = Multimap.parseUrlEncoded(data.readString());
completed.onCompleted(null);
}
catch (Exception e) {
completed.onCompleted(e);
}
}
});
}
public UrlEncodedFormBody() {
}
@Override
public boolean readFullyOnRequest() {
return true;
}
@Override
public int length() {
if (mBodyBytes == null)
buildData();
return mBodyBytes.length;
}
@Override
public Multimap get() {
return mParameters;
}
}
